Amiga Power still [!!] devides alot of opinion. Some cherish the magazine somwhat obsessively at times, this may be due to the nostalgia that emerges when a thing or time manifests in the memory with no immediate contact. Looking back,many of the reasons I liked AP was due to the fact that I was in my mid to early teens. As a grown man I view it a little differently.

There are also those people who dislike AP, who wanted what mags such as the One and Amiga Action offered. Whilst they certaily aren't my cup of tea I can imagine that readers who liked those magazines wouldnt get along with AP. rather like people who liked certain games and those who liked others..

Perhaps more people need to read the actually magazine to get an idea of what it was?

Those games Judas likes are all games that did nothing for me, except for Zool 2 and, at a push, Fire and Ice. All the others were supersceded by later games. Incidentally, Core had nothing to do wtih Switchblade 2, only the first one. I suspect none of you completed the first level fo Switchblade 2 - it's brilliant after that. As for people talking up Defender of the Crown or Dungeon Master for inclusion -it's a list of the ebst games, not the most origianl or techncially-impressive.
